Synthesis of Boranoate, Selenoate, and Thioate Analogs of AZTp(4)A and Ap(4)A
We report efficient, one-flask procedures for the synthesis of a family of fourteen analogs of AZTp(4)A and Ap(4)A containing BH(3), S, or Se, along with two bisphosphonate analogs of Ap(4)A.
